The Young and the Restless recap for Tuesday, January 23, 2024, brings a realization for Ashley about how to get the truth about what happened in Paris

Young and the Restless Recap Highlights

Also in this episode, Kyle and Summer caught up. Sharon and Chance had an encounter that went well. Jack reassured Diane that she hadn’t taken Kyle’s job. Traci helped Ashley decide what to do next. And Nikki provided surprising support for Claire. Now, let’s dig deeper into what went down.

Awkward Encounters

At Crimson Lights, Summer (Allison Lanier) walked in and bumped into Kyle (Michael Mealor). They were a little sad, but they talked about creating memories for their son, Harrison.

Summer asked about Kyle’s job at Jabot, and he told her he wasn’t in the co-CEO role again; instead, Diane had taken the position. Despite putting on a positive front, Kyle couldn’t entirely hide his disappointment in the situation.

Chance (Conner Floyd) showed up, and Summer had him model his new suit. When Chance went to grab a coffee, Kyle teased Summer about crushing on Chance. Kyle said he was glad to see her smiling again.

Later after Kyle left, Summer and Chance discussed his new job and the dynamics. Sharon (Sharon Case) entered, briefly interrupting their conversation. Things with the trio were somewhat strained at first, but they acted like adults and had a reasonable conversation. When Summer stepped away, Sharon told Chance not to act awkward around her. They reflected on the past and talked about how they were on good terms before Chance and Summer left for work.

The Truth

Meanwhile, at Jabot, Jack (Peter Bergman) assured Diane (Susan Walters) that she wasn’t taking the opportunity away from their son (refresh your memory on how she got the position here). He told her it was her time to shine. However, Diane worried about Kyle’s feelings, especially since he had setbacks in both his career and personal life recently. Jack remained confident in Kyle’s resilience. He felt that their son would learn from those experiences.

They started making out, and Kyle interrupted. Jack left, and Diane talked to Kyle about her taking the job he’d wanted. He told his mom she was sure she’d crush it, but when they hugged, he looked unhappy. 

At the Genoa City Athletic Club, Ashley (Eileen Davidson) confronted Tucker (Trevor St. John) at his suite. They talked about their relationship issues, and she accused him of gaslighting her. Tucker laughed in her face about her accusations, and he suggested that she was the one who was rewriting history. He told her to fly back to Paris and ask people at the bistro what had happened that day.

Their heated exchange led Ashley to question her own perceptions. Back at home, Ashley talked to her sister Traci (Beth Maitland). Together, Ashley and Traci considered how they could uncover the truth.

New Bonds

At the psychiatric hospital, Claire (Hayley Erin) woke up to find Nikki (Melody Thomas Scott) at her bedside. Nikki offered support and acknowledged Claire’s troubled past. She encouraged her newfound granddaughter to embrace healing. 

Claire wondered whether she was inherently evil, which prompted Nikki to talk about strength and the potential for positive change. Claire thought about her life, and she expressed envy towards children with supportive families and contemplated being raised as a weapon. She asked Nikki to tell her about Victoria as a child, and Nikki obliged. 

Nikki went out of Claire’s room, reaching for her flask, but she stopped. Instead, Nikki reached out to Jack for help, hinting at a personal crisis.
